INSIDE ISSUE #75

DEATH SONGS OF A DEMON BARBER
Tim Burton’s bloodiest movie ever also happens to be his first live-action musical. The director helps us get to the meat of Sweeney Todd, his fiercest fable yet. Plus: The real Fleet Street, the Sweeney Todd stage production, and more!
by Liisa Ladouceur, Trevor Tuminski, James Burrell and Jovanka Vuckovic

WHEN THERE’S NO MORE ROOM IN HELL…
They won’t stay dead! With zombies having seemingly infected every corner of pop culture, the man who started it all 40 years ago returns with Diary of the Dead to show us how it’s done. Plus: Interviews with the directors of the experimental zombie film The Signal, a look at Babylon Fields, the undead TV series that almost was, and a spotlight on zombie portrait artist Rob Sachetto.
by Stuart Andrews, Last Chance Lance, Dave Alexander and Jovanka Vuckovic

THE DEFINITIVE 2008 CONVENTION SCHEDULE
Map out the coming year in horror with this indispensable guide to the best genre events around the globe.
by Staff

R.I.P. 2007: THE YEAR IN REVIEW
Our annual awards for standout genre contributions as well as a few you should have missed.
by Staff
